For > your purposes, the important things to note are: > > 1) The mutex has moved from selinux_fs_info to selinux_state and is > now named policy_mutex. You will need to take it around your call to > security_read_policy_kernel(). > > 2) security_policydb_len() was removed and security_read_policy() just > directly reads the policydb len. You can do the same from your > security_read_policy_kernel() variant. > > 3) Ondrej has a pending change to move the policycap[] array from > selinux_state to selinux_policy so that it can be atomically updated > with the policy. > > 4) Ondrej has a pending change to eliminate the separate initialized > boolean from selinux_state and just test whether selinux_state.policy > is non-NULL but as long as you are using selinux_initialized() to > test, your code should be unaffected. > Thanks a lot for the update Stephen.
